Crystal structure of ChoE, a bacterial acetylcholinesterase from Pseudomonas aeruginosa
X-RAY DIFFRACTION
Crystallization
| Crystalization Experiments | ||||
|---|---|---|---|---|
| ID | Method | pH | Temperature | Details |
| 1 | MICROBATCH | 6.5 | 277 | 25% PEG8000, 0.1 M MES, pH 6.5 |
| Crystal Properties | |
|---|---|
| Matthews coefficient | Solvent content |
| 3.01 | 59.1 |
Crystal Data
| Unit Cell | |
|---|---|
| Length ( Å ) | Angle ( ˚ ) |
| a = 82.157 | α = 90 |
| b = 109.673 | β = 90 |
| c = 84.22 | γ = 90 |
| Symmetry | |
|---|---|
| Space Group | C 2 2 21 |
